Prerequisite

Students are required to have a minimum of one-year of pre-hospital experience working as an EMT prior to the application deadline. 
Students who possess EMT Intermediate Certification for a minimum of one year that have not completed their EMT Basic Certificate at TCC will receive Prior Learning Assessment (PLA) credits that are equivalent to EMS 110 & EMS 111 for a total of 12 credits. Certification requires state licensure and/or national licensure with Registry (NREMT).
